Title :
Decision Support for Handling Mismatches between COTS Products and System Requirements
Author :
Mohamed, Abdallah ; Ruhe, Guenther ; Eberlein, Armin
Author_Institution :
Calgary Univ., Alta.
fDate :
Feb. 26 2007-March 2 2007
Abstract :
In the process of selecting commercial off-the-shelf (COTS) products, it is inevitable to encounter mismatches between COTS products and system requirements. Mismatches occur when COTS attributes do not exactly match our requirements. Many of these mismatches are resolved after selecting a COTS product in order to improve its fitness with the requirements. This paper proposes a decision support approach that aims at addressing COTS mismatches during and after the selection process. Our approach can be integrated with existing COTS selection methods at two stages: (I) When evaluating COTS candidates: our approach is used to estimate the anticipated fitness of the candidates if their mismatches are resolved. This helps to base our COTS selection decisions on the fitness that the COTS candidates will eventually have if selected. (2) After selecting a COTS product: the approach suggests alternative plans for resolving the most appropriate mismatches using suitable actions, such that the most important risk, technical, and resource constraints are met. A case study from the e-services domain is used to illustrate the method and to discuss its added value
Keywords :
decision support systems; software packages; software performance evaluation; software selection; COTS attributes; COTS mismatches; COTS products; COTS selection methods; commercial off-the-shelf products; decision support; resource constraints; system requirements; Decision making; Humans; Open source software; Portfolios; Qualifications; Software systems;
Conference_Titel :
Commercial-off-the-Shelf (COTS)-Based Software Systems, 2007. ICCBSS '07. Sixth International IEEE Conference on
Conference_Location :
Banff, Alta.
Print_ISBN :
0-7695-2785-X
DOI :
10.1109/ICCBSS.2007.13